The Mercia Laptop is supplied with a 3,800 mAh battery which has been cleverly built into the chassis design rather than protruding out the back. We set the brightness at a mid way point and left Wi-Fi enabled. We tested performing general duties, such as checking email, using Microsoft Office, surfing the net and chatting online. We then played a 1080P movie via the internal screen to measure performance under a more continual load.
Battery life is not particularly impressive, with around 90 minutes under general use. When watching a movie as the image shows above, we scraped just under 1 hour before the system had to shut down. A second battery would be a good option if you need to work a lot on the move.
